A Building Surveyor is required to provide a fast, efficient and cost effective planned and reactive contract works service including all surveys. The successful applicant must be able to produce CAD drawings and specifications relating to all types of projects on schools and corporate buildings, some surveying at height and in roof voids may be required.

Key responsibilities:

Provide technical advice/assistance, information and guidance on any issues relating to the definition of client needs and requirements within the function of planned maintenance and contract works. Assist in the provision of technical advice, assistance, information and guidance on any issues relating to the definition of client needs and requirements.
Evaluate the effects of, report on and adjust contract specifications to accommodate any changes in or variations to the needs and requirements of the client.
Produce CAD drawings and specifications relating to all types of projects on schools and corporate buildings.
Supervise contracts and monitor progress as well as maintain quality control and cost control standards in the implementation of all work relating to planned maintenance and contract works.
Provide assistance to the Lead Building Surveyor and Senior Building Surveyor with the development and control of work programmes and appropriate performance indicators.
Maintain and monitor safe and responsible working methods in accordance with legal requirements, complete Risk assessments and ensure safe methods of working are in place
Undertake all types of building surveys, Whole life Cycle costing, including measured surveys, determine maintenance/work/inspection programmes, management programmes and assist in the preparation of comprehensive written reports.
Assist in the planning and programming of annual cycles of work, surveys and work programmes including costing of same.
Assist in monitoring budgets including those budgets allocated to the post holder.
